A system of compensating phenological responses of different species to unusual rainfall conditions may play a major role in maintaining an orderly, staggered sequence of flowering peaks among the hummingbird-pollinated plants of a Costa Rican rain forest. Quantitative phenological studies over several years may be essential to understanding the temporal organization of many tropical communities.
